As indicated by L’Equipe on Tuesday, Nuno Mendes will resume well during the month of January and could therefore be available for PSG’s round of 16 against Real Sociedad (first leg on February 14).
Luis Enrique, PSG coach, will be able to count on a new left back for the second half of the season. Having undergone surgery on a hamstring muscle at the end of September, Nuno Mendes is continuing his rehabilitation normally, as assured by the entourage of the 21-year-old Portuguese international. Nuno Mendes, announced to be absent for four months at the time, should resume from mid-January and would therefore be operational for the round of 16 first leg of the Champions League against Real Sociedad, on February 14 at the Parc des Princes. The return leg in San Sebastian is scheduled for March 5, which is more than enough for the powerful left-hander to regain the rhythm of the high level.
